Gaussian is a function with the nice property of being separable, which means that a 2d gaussian function can be computed by combining two 1d gaussian functions.

In vray, an image sampler refers to an algorithm for sampling and filtering the image function, and producing the final array of pixels that constitute the rendered image. In the first pass, a onedimensional kernel is used to blur the image in only the horizontal or vertical direction. A gaussian blur works by sampling the color values of pixels in a radius around a central pixel, then applying a weight to each of these colors based on a gaussian distribution function. Using a gaussian blur filter before edge detection aims to reduce the level of noise in the image, which improves the result of the following edgedetection algorithm.
